A jury in Houston returned a $352 million verdict Monday for a ramp service agent hit by a van while on the job at George Bush Intercontinental Airport.

“If you knew the injuries, you’d wonder why it wasn’t more,” said winning lawyer Randy Sorrels of Sorrels Law in Houston. “This was not a runaway jury.” He told Law.com the jury deliberated all day Friday and half of Monday to end the two-week trial before 127th Judicial District Court Judge Ravi Sandill.
